Playa del Carmen bridge deterioration poses safety risks

Residents in Playa del Carmen are raising alarms regarding the deteriorating condition of a major vehicular bridge that connects the city to Cancún and the rest of the Riviera Maya. Local citizens report that pieces of concrete frequently detach from the structure, posing a direct threat to the hundreds of people who pass beneath it daily.

Of particular concern is a basketball court located near Avenida Juárez, which is used daily by families and youth. Witnesses have shared images of fallen debris, including a large rock that recently detached near the municipal cemetery. The bridge, which spans approximately 4 kilometers and carries over 20,000 vehicles daily, was inaugurated in 2011.

Community members are calling on federal authorities to invest in necessary maintenance and are urging Protección Civil to conduct an immediate safety inspection to determine if pedestrian access beneath the bridge should be restricted.
